Moving from Charlotte to Myrtle Beach

Moving from Charlotte, North Carolina to Myrtle Beach, South Carolina covers approximately 153 miles, classifying this as an interstate move. Pricing depends on factors like the size of your home and the level of service required. Delivery typically takes one day, with options for standard or expedited service. Understanding these elements helps you plan your move efficiently.

How much does it cost to move from Charlotte to Myrtle Beach?

Moving costs between Charlotte and Myrtle Beach vary based on the size of your household and services chosen. Small moves generally range from $653 to $661, medium moves from $751 to $760, and large moves from $849 to $859.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, packing needs, and timing. Comparing quotes from different movers can help you find the best fit for your budget.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Charlotte to Myrtle Beach

Here are common questions about moving from Charlotte, NC to Myrtle Beach, SC to help you plan your interstate move.

How much does it typically cost to move from Charlotte to Myrtle Beach?

Moving costs vary by home size and services. Small moves range from $653 to $661, medium moves from $751 to $760, and large moves from $849 to $859. Additional services like packing or storage can affect the final price.

What is the usual delivery timeline for this route?

Delivery between Charlotte and Myrtle Beach typically takes one day. Both standard and expedited delivery options are available, allowing you to choose based on your schedule and budget.

What is the cheapest moving option for this interstate route?

The most affordable option is usually a small move with minimal additional services. Booking early and opting for standard delivery can also help reduce costs.

When should I book my move to ensure availability and better rates?

Booking your move several weeks in advance is recommended to secure availability and competitive pricing. Last-minute bookings may result in higher costs or limited options.

Are movers on this route required to have interstate licenses?

Yes, moving companies operating between North Carolina and South Carolina must be licensed interstate movers. This ensures compliance with federal regulations and protects your shipment.

What logistics should I consider when moving from Charlotte to Myrtle Beach?

Consider the 153-mile distance, delivery timing, and service options. Interstate moves require coordination with licensed movers, and factors like packing and storage needs can affect scheduling and cost.
